var encarr = new Array();
var decarr = new Array();
var map1 = "abcdefghijklmnopqrstuvwxyzABCDEFGHIJKLMNOPQRSTUVWXYZ!@#$%^&*()-+<>_+= :.";
var map2 = "qazwsxedcrfvtgbyhnujmikolpQAZWSXEDCRFVTGBYHNUJMIKOLP+-)(*&^%$#@!_+<> =.:";
for (i=0; i<map1.length; i++)
{
    encarr[map1.charAt(i)] = map2.charAt(i);
    decarr[map2.charAt(i)] = map1.charAt(i);
}
function codify(a,f)
{
   	arr = (f) ? encarr : decarr;  	
    s = "";
    for (i=0; i<a.length; i++)
    {
        if (!arr[a.charAt(i)])
      	    s = s + a.charAt(i);
        else
      		s = s + arr[a.charAt(i)];
    }
    return s;
}

function eo(a,b,c)
{
	if (!c) c = a + codify("-",0) + b;
    document.write(codify("_q=dnsx tqcvjb.",0) + a + codify("-",0) + b + codify("+") + c + codify("_/q+",0));
}
